Thanks for posting the vid.
Looks like you got it right at 1:44 and you can see your car was at least one car width to the right of where it was when you spun at 3:42.
The obvious bump made the rear end light at the track positon you placed the car which caused enough rotation that overwhelmed the sterring part of the car. In other words kind of like rear bump steer.
Have you adjusted the compression of the rear shocks? If not I'd dial another two clicks and see if it improves.
